“Mean Girls” actor Jonathan Bennett will star in Hallmark’s first LGBTQ-themed holiday movie, “The Christmas House,” the network announced Wednesday. About two months ago, the Hallmark Channel announced that its 2020 holiday movie selection would include LGBTQ storylines, characters and actors. Now, the television cable channel is making good on its promise.
“Our holiday table is bigger and more welcoming than ever,” Michelle Vicary, the executive VP of programming at Crown Media, Hallmark’s parent company, said Wednesday. “This year’s movies reflect our most diverse representation of talent, narratives, and families, including ‘The Christmas House’, featuring a storyline about a gay couple looking to adopt their first child,
